{"id":"AZL-88412","summary":"CVE-2026-23679 affecting package libusb1 1.0.27-4","details":"libusb before version 1.0.30 contains a NULL pointer dereference vulnerability that allows attackers to crash applications by supplying a malformed USB configuration descriptor where an interface claims bNumEndpoints greater than zero but is followed by a class-specific descriptor whose bLength exceeds the remaining buffer size, causing parse_interface() to return early without allocating the endpoint array. Attackers can exploit this flaw through libusb_get_active_config_descriptor or libusb_get_config_descriptor by providing crafted descriptors via virtualized USB passthrough, file-based descriptor parsing, or network sources, causing any application iterating over endpoints to dereference a NULL endpoint pointer and crash.","modified":"2026-08-30T05:24:52Z","published":"2026-05-27T14:16:44Z","upstream":["CVE-2026-23679"],"references":[{"type":"WEB","url":"https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2026-23679"}],"affected":[{"package":{"name":"libusb1","ecosystem":"Azure Linux:3","purl":"pkg:rpm/azure-linux/libusb1"},"ranges":[{"type":"ECOSYSTEM","events":[{"introduced":"0"},{"last_affected":"1.0.27-4"}]}],"database_specific":{"source":"https://github.com/microsoft/AzureLinuxVulnerabilityData/blob/main/osv/AZL-88412.json"}}],"schema_version":"1.9.0"}
